A man has been arrested after allegedly stealing items from a building site at Port Noarlunga South.
Police were called to a property on Morningstar Avenue at about 5am on Sunday 17 April after reports that a man was trespassing.
On arrival, officers located the suspect on nearby Jared Road. He was searched and allegedly found in possession of a water meter, copper piping and breaking tools.
A further search of the area located the suspect's Subaru wagon parked nearby with unassigned number plates. A search of the vehicle uncovered additional copper piping, believed to be stolen.
The 44-year-old man from Port Noarlunga was arrested and charged with being unlawfully on premises, carrying an article of disguise, unlawful possession and possessing breaking tools. He was granted bail to appear in the Christies Beach Magistrates Court on 4 June.
The man's Subaru was seized for further examination.
